通貨 is the general term for a country's currency system. 貨幣 emphasizes physical coins and notes, often in historical or economic discussions. 外貨 specifically means foreign currency.
The loanword カレンシー exists but is rarely used outside technical financial contexts. Stick to 通貨 for most situations.
